Threefold byAlexia RubodI.It is three fold. First step is the loss. It comes with a mental frenzy. It is ineffable to everything in you that once made sense. Your body shatters to pieces and some of them are nowhere to be found. A desire to escape. How do you accept what is ? When what is, is so unacceptable. You look for the loophole. The point where space bends time. In your dreams, perhaps. This pull inwards that allows you to disappear for a moment. Here they are. The missing pieces. In your dreams you run. And you cry. You cry rivers.Patience.From rivers, new trees are born.II.But then, something else. One morning you wake up. Your body is still sore but you notice a possibility to rise. Layers are dissolving. Things get clearer, almost transparent. There’s a light outside. It’s formless. Empty. It’s scary. The abundance of space is scary. Stepping in the unknown is scary. Out of this quiet paralysis. The horizon, a white blur. Do you still know how to walk ? You’re willing to try, you’re willing to fall. To learn from scratch. One piece at a time. Your soul murmurs words you didn’t know you knew. Your knees are a bit weak. You don’t know where you’re going.Yet somehow, you’re on your way.III.The pain is still there. It might always be. You don’t move on, you move with. The pain has transformed as you were putting the pieces back together. It has transcended. It happened in the background. A dim space tucked away. In the time it took you, to remember who you were. You had to break to wake up. To die to be born something new. It’s not perfect. But it’s warm and bright. It’s real. And now, at last, you see.Somewhere in the dark, you found it.And it brought you home. -- source link
